Step 1: Define Your Business Needs

Do you operate in one city or multiple states? Do you have a small fleet of 10 cars or a large one with hundreds? The size and scope of your business will help determine the features you need.

Step 2: Look for Must-Have Features

The best taxi dispatch system should include:

  1. Automated ride assignments

  2. Driver and passenger apps

  3. GPS tracking

  4. Multi-payment support

  5. Cloud-based operations

Step 3: Prioritize Scalability

Your fleet may be small today, but what about in two years? A system that can grow with your business is essential for long-term success.

Step 4: Consider Customer Experience

In the U.S., customers expect digital convenience. A dispatch system must make booking simple, payment seamless, and ride tracking transparent.
